Output 3b63732166eaf294f7aeb4121ccebb87d3732b503dabc2ed18d9d09e95336f2a:0

value
21183
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 58f8c448337209ba47a641df390da207c497422328cee6f356ae807a86130dae
address
bc1ptruvgjpnwgym53axg80njrdzqlzfws3r9r8wdu6k46q84psnpkhqqcd392
transaction
3b63732166eaf294f7aeb4121ccebb87d3732b503dabc2ed18d9d09e95336f2a
spent
true